The biological vector for West Nile encephalitis is the mosquito. Specific species, such as Culex pipiens, are notably involved in the transmission of the virus to humans. West Nile encephalitis is caused by the West Nile virus, which primarily affects birds but can also infect humans and other mammals. The virus is transmitted through the bite of an infected mosquito. Preventing West Nile encephalitis involves a combination of personal protective measures and community efforts. You should use insect repellent, wear long sleeves, and avoid outdoor activities during peak mosquito feeding times.
